Pros of Improving Classic Cars



Restoring vintage cars has countless advantages that make it a preferred selection amongst fanatics.

To start with, it allows you to tailor the car according to your preferences and design. You have the freedom to pick the color, interior, and even add contemporary upgrades while still keeping the timeless appeal.

Second of all, bring back a vintage car can be a satisfying and fulfilling experience. It offers you the possibility to learn brand-new skills and gain understanding regarding automotive auto mechanics. You reach be hands-on with the repair procedure, from dismantling the vehicle to rebuilding it, which adds a sense of accomplishment.

Additionally, recovering a vintage car can be a wise monetary investment. With the appropriate repair, the car's worth can boost dramatically, permitting you to possibly make a profit if you choose to sell it in the future.

Pros and Cons of Purchasing Fully Restored Classic Automobiles



If you're thinking about buying a completely restored classic automobile, there are both advantages and negative aspects to consider.

One of the most significant benefits is that you'll have a vintage car that's in excellent condition and prepared to be delighted in quickly. You won't need to stress over the time and effort needed to restore a vehicle on your own.

In addition, acquiring a totally brought back classic car can be a good investment, as the value of these cars often tends to value with time.

However, there are additionally some downsides to buying a fully restored vintage car.

The cost can be fairly high, as you're spending for the labor and proficiency that went into the restoration. In addition, there's constantly a threat that the remediation had not been done correctly, which can lead to continuous upkeep concerns.
